What is omni channel?

Omni channel, at its core, is a strategy that integrates various sales and marketing channels to provide a seamless and consistent experience for customers. This means breaking down the barriers between online and offline retail, mobile and desktop shopping, and even social media and in-store interactions.

The term 'omni' itself implies 'all' or 'every,' and that's precisely what this approach aims to achieve: a holistic and unified customer experience across all touchpoints. Whether customers interact with brands through a physical store, website, mobile app, or social media, omni channel ensures that the journey is consistent, convenient, and personalized.

Discover the many omni channel trends across industries

While the world of retail is perhaps the first and most well-known industry to adopt omni channel strategies, it is a misconception that omni channel isn’t for other industries. In reality, omni channel is all around us and is being utilized in innovative ways across industries to redefine customer experiences:


Omni channel retail trends

For instance, in omni channel retail, trends like Click-and-Collect and BOPIS (Buy Online Pay In Store) are on the rise with over 50% of retailers offering BOPIS options and 60% of online shoppers availing it at least once a month.


Omni channel banking trends

In omni channel banking, digital banking is in-trend and mobile wallets are now nearly the norm, enabling contactless payments and peer-to-peer transfers, with around 2.8 billion mobile wallets in use worldwide since 2022.


Omni channel travel trends

Thanks to omni channel travel integrations, travelers seamlessly switch between mobile apps, websites, and even smart devices like voice assistants or smart watches, in order to book flights, hotels, and local travel on the go, while receiving real-time updates via SMS, apps, email, or voice assistants.


Omni channel manufacturing trends

Manufacturers employ IoT sensors and tracking systems to provide real-time supply chain visibility to customers and partners. Another manufacturing omni channel logistics trend is “Configure-to-Order” where customers can customize products online, and manufacturers produce them to order, reducing excess inventory.

Omni channel healthcare trends

Thanks to omni channel healthcare strategies, patients can now avail telemedicine services, consulting with doctors remotely. Patients use mobile apps and wearables to track health metrics and receive personalized recommendations. Advanced pharmacies offer online prescription refills, automated reminders, and in-store pickup options, providing patients with flexibility and convenience.

Why omni channel will matter in 2024 and beyond!


Omni channel strategies aim to enhance customer satisfaction, drive sales, and provide valuable insights into customer behavior by creating a cohesive and personalized journey across various platforms. The benefits of omni channel include:

1. Enhanced customer experiences

In a world where convenience is king, customers expect a seamless journey across all touchpoints. Omni channel ensures that customers can transition effortlessly from one channel to another without losing context. For instance, they can browse products on the website and complete purchases through a mobile app. Omni channel helps create a unified ecosystem where data and customer interactions flow seamlessly.

2. Improved personalization

Personalization is a cornerstone of omni channel success. Combining unified customer profiles with AI-driven insights, businesses can tailor their marketing efforts and product recommendations to individual customer preferences. It enables personalized product recommendations on e-commerce websites to customize in-store experiences based on past interactions. By harnessing AI and BI, omni channel strategies involve analyzing customer preferences and purchase history to deliver relevant promotions and offers in real-time.

3. Holistic inventory management

Omni channel significantly enhances inventory management by providing a unified view of stock levels across all sales channels. With real-time visibility into inventory, businesses can prevent stockouts and overstock situations, ensuring that products are available when and where customers want them. This improved control over inventory leads to better demand forecasting and order fulfillment, reducing costly inefficiencies.

4. Increased sales and revenue

By providing a consistent and convenient shopping experience, omni channel commerce reduces friction in the buying process. When customers can seamlessly switch between online and offline shopping or access products via mobile apps and social media, it encourages more frequent engagement and purchases.  Personalized recommendations and targeted promotions also increase the likelihood of upselling and cross-selling, maximizing the average transaction value
